出 处:《舰船电子工程》2024年第10期119-123,138,共6页Ship Electronic Engineering
摘 要:为评价无人机集群系统性能优劣,选用适当评估方法对其进行效能评估显得十分必要。针对评估过程中确定指标权重时运用传统层次分析法易受主观因素影响的问题,论文提出基于组合赋权的方法,引入熵权将由定性评价得到的指标权重值加以修正,减少主观因素带来的不利影响,最后利用仿真平台进行验证,结果表明方法的可行性。研究成果可为研究无人机集群作战效能评估问题提供一定思路和方法。It is necessary to select appropriate evaluation methods to evaluate the performance of unmanned aerial vehicle swarm cluster systems.In response to the issue of using traditional analytic hierarchy process(AHP)to determine indicator weights during the evaluation process,which is susceptible to subjective factors,this paper proposes a method based on combination weighting.Entropy weight is introduced to modify the indicator weight values obtained from qualitative evaluation,reducing the adverse effects caused by subjective factors.Finally,a simulation platform is used to verify the feasibility of the method.The research results can provide certain ideas and methods for studying the effectiveness evaluation of unmanned aerial vehicle swarm cluster operations.
